Woman injured after being hit by vehicle on Park RoadBenicia CA

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.

audio iconTraffic
Park Rd, Benicia, CA 94510

A female pedestrian was injured and has swelling in her leg after being struck by a vehicle near Park Road in Benicia. Medical units responded to the scene.
